This program is designed for individuals interested in sustainable, self-sufficient living through permaculture and organic practices. Set in the serene Himalayan foothills, this retreat offers hands-on permaculture training and insights into sustainable, organic agriculture. Participants will learn practical skills to create eco-friendly living systems, from soil health and composting to water management and natural building techniques. This immersive course is perfect for those wanting to embrace a simpler, nature-connected lifestyle and develop skills for sustainable living.
Location: Eco-village in the Himalayan region, surrounded by natural beauty.
Duration: 12 days
Focus Areas: Permaculture design principles, organic farming techniques, sustainable water and soil management, natural building, and holistic wellness.
Learning Outcomes:
Permaculture Skills: Ability to design and maintain sustainable food and living systems.
Organic Agriculture Knowledge: Understanding of soil health, composting, and organic gardening for eco-friendly food production.
Natural Building Techniques: Practical experience in constructing with natural, local materials.
Water and Waste Management: Knowledge of water conservation, rainwater harvesting, and sustainable waste practices.
Lifestyle Transformation: Skills to lead a more self-sufficient, sustainable lifestyle that aligns with permaculture ethics.
